Hyderabad has achieved a significant milestone in artificial intelligence infrastructure, with its live data centre capacity doubling over the past three years. This growth positions the city as a rising hub for AI data centres in India, backed by Telangana's strategic incentives.
Telangana's AI Ambitions
The state government has introduced targeted policies to attract investments in high-density GPU clusters, large-scale training compute, and advanced liquid cooling systems. These measures aim to establish Hyderabad as a global AI data centre destination.
Key Incentives
- Subsidies for high-performance GPUs
- Support for large-scale training compute infrastructure
- Promotion of liquid cooling technologies for energy efficiency
Industry experts note that the doubling of live capacity reflects growing demand from AI startups, research institutions, and enterprises. The state's focus on sustainable cooling solutions also aligns with global environmental standards.
Impact on the Ecosystem
This expansion is expected to boost local employment, attract further investments, and enhance India's position in the global AI landscape. Hyderabad already hosts major tech firms and research labs, making it a natural choice for AI infrastructure growth.
The Telangana government continues to work with industry stakeholders to ensure that the region remains competitive. Officials believe that the combination of policy support and existing tech talent will drive further capacity additions in the coming years.
